Trump posts new AI image of himself embraced by Jesus amid backlash over earlier post
The post drew backlash from Christian conservatives and Pope Leo XIV allies, as Trump doubled down with a caption mocking critics.
- On Wednesday, President Donald Trump reposted an AI-generated image from an X account called "Irish for Trump," depicting Jesus embracing him, captioning it, "The Radical Left Lunatics might not like this, but I think it is quite nice!!!"
- The repost followed Trump's Monday deletion of an earlier AI image depicting him as a Christ-like healer after widespread criticism. Trump claimed to reporters he thought the image depicted him "as a doctor," and Speaker Mike Johnson said he asked Trump to delete the photo.
- Prominent conservative journalist Megan Basham labeled the imagery "OUTRAGEOUS blasphemy," while commentator Cam Higby, a long-time Trump supporter, stated he spends "8 hours a day" defending Trump but "will not defend blasphemy."
- Trump's recent attacks on Pope Leo XIV, calling him "WEAK on Crime," coincide with the image controversy.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ni, a Trump ally, subsequently called his remarks about the Pope "unacceptable."
- These controversies risk alienating Catholic voters, who form about 20 per cent of the U.S. population, as sustained backlash could depress turnout among these critical religious constituencies in upcoming midterm races.
